Loading...

Find Jobs

Showing 679 jobs

August 13, 2025 by
Illinois Tool Works
August 13, 2025 by
Water Technologies - Elga
August 13, 2025 by
Water Technologies - Elga
August 13, 2025 by
Evolution Security
August 13, 2025 by
Teaching Personnel
August 13, 2025 by
Paradigm Housing